1560-01-314-3655 Freight Data Freight Information 1560-01-314-3655

1560-01-314-3655 has freight characteristics.It has a National Motor Freight Classification (NMFC) of 172400. A Sub NMFC of X. It has a NMFC Description of SASH GLAZED/NOT/FRAMES COMB/WNDWS. 1560-01-314-3655 is rated as class 125 when transported by Less-Than Truckload (LTL) freight. 1560-01-314-3655 is rated as class 125 when transported by Less-Than Carload (LCL) rail or ocean freight. It has a Uniform Freight Classification (UFC) number of 84610 which rates the freight between FCL and LCL. 1560-01-314-3655 has a variance between NMFC and UFC when transported by rail and the description should be consulted. It has a Water Commodity Code (WCC) of 704 for ocean manifesting and military sealift. 1560-01-314-3655 is not classified as a special type of cargo when transported by water. 1560-01-314-3655 is not a consolidation and does not exceed 84" in any dimension. It should be compatible with a standard 72" Aircraft Cargo Door when transported by air.
